Desktop Support Supervisor

Location: Union City, NJ (On-Site)

About the Opportunity

Our client is seeking an experienced Desktop Support Supervisor to lead the day-to-day operations of its IT support team. This is a hands-on leadership role responsible for ensuring exceptional technical support while mentoring a team of desktop support professionals in a fast-paced educational environment.

The ideal candidate is a strong technical leader with excellent communication skills who is fluent in both English and Spanish and has experience supporting users in a school or educational setting.

Responsibilities

  • Supervise and mentor a team of Desktop Support Technicians
  • Assign, prioritize, and monitor daily support requests to ensure timely resolution
  • Provide hands-on desktop, laptop, printer, and peripheral support when needed
  • Troubleshoot hardware, software, networking, and end-user issues
  • Support Windows operating systems, Microsoft 365, Active Directory, and common business applications
  • Manage user accounts, permissions, and workstation deployments
  • Coordinate equipment installations, upgrades, and replacements
  • Ensure IT support tickets are resolved within established service levels
  • Maintain accurate documentation of support activities and IT assets
  • Partner with school administrators, faculty, and staff to deliver outstanding customer service
  • Assist with IT projects, technology rollouts, and classroom technology support

Qualifications

  • 5+ years of Desktop Support experience
  • 2+ years of experience leading or supervising an IT support team
  • Fluent in both English and Spanish (required)
  • Previous experience working in a K-12 school, school district, college, or educational environment is highly preferred
  • Strong knowledge of:
    • Windows 10/11
    • Microsoft 365
    • Active Directory
    • Desktop and laptop hardware
    • Printers and peripherals
    • Basic networking concepts
  • Experience with ticketing systems and IT asset management
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and organizational skills
  • Strong customer service mindset with the ability to support both technical and non-technical users

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ience supporting classroom technology
  • Experience with Google Workspace for Education
  • Knowledge of audiovisual classroom equipment
  • CompTIA A+, Network+, or Microsoft certifications are a plus
